<p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r">Press reports indicated that the Saudi Al-Hilal Club is once again seeking to sign a player from the Spanish club Las Palmas, during the upcoming winter transfer period, as the Spanish player Alberto Molero, the winger of the Las Palmas team, was a target for Al-Hilal during the last summer transfer period.</p><h2 style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> <span style="color:hsl(180, 75%, 60%);">Al Hilal negotiations to sign Moliro</span></h2><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> According to reports, <a target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er" href="https://news.sbisiali.com/news/article/decisive-confrontation-will-al-ain-succeed-in-stopping-al-hilals-train">Al Hilal</a> management has contacted him again to inquire about the player, and Luis Helguera, the sporting director of Las Palmas, stated that Al Hilal and other clubs from the Saudi Roshen League have expressed verbal interest in signing the 21-year-old player.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> "We have not yet made a comprehensive assessment of the situation from a technical or financial standpoint," Helguera added.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> He also pointed out that the expected financial value of the deal may be higher than the amount requested during the last summer transfer period, adding that the details will become clearer as the winter transfer period approaches next January.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> It is worth noting that Al Hilal began talks with the Spanish club Las Palmas to sign the young Spanish player, but the summer transfer period ended without reaching a financial agreement that would satisfy all parties.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> Molero has participated in 10 matches with his team this season, for a total of 776 minutes of play, during which he scored 4 goals, without providing any assists, according to statistics from the international website “Transfer Market”.</p>
